AI summary of 4 reviews · as of May 2026

Nokia built an unmatched reputation for durability and reliability in the feature-phone era but failed to adapt to smartphones, leaving behind a legacy brand that now trades on nostalgia rather than innovation.

Where reviewers disagree: One reviewer sees Nokia's optical networking pivot as a real AI infrastructure play with strong growth, while others focus solely on the phone legacy and its nostalgia appeal; Some view modern Nokia feature phones as practical secondary or backup devices, while others see them purely as novelty throwbacks

Mixed reviews

What they praise

  • Legendary build quality and physical durability across classic models that earned a reputation for being nearly indestructible
  • Long battery life that provided days or even a week of standby on feature phones
  • Simple, reliable user experience focused on core functions without distraction
  • Strong emotional connection and nostalgia rooted in being many people's first phone
  • Pioneered mobile technology with features like T9 predictive text and early mobile multimedia

What they knock

  • Failed to transition to the smartphone era by clinging too long to the outdated Symbian operating system
  • Windows Phone pivot lacked essential apps and ecosystem support despite attractive hardware design
  • Modern revivals are feature phones or low-end devices that cannot compete with contemporary smartphones
  • Operating margins remain thin even as the company shifts focus to infrastructure hardware

Who reviewers think this brand is — and isn’t — for

For you if

People seeking a simple backup phone for occasional use, digital detox weekends, or those chasing nostalgia for the pre-smartphone era.

Look elsewhere if

Anyone who needs a primary smartphone with a modern app ecosystem, competitive performance, or cutting-edge features.

  • What is Nokia known for?

    Reviewers say Nokia built an unmatched reputation for durability and reliability during the feature-phone era, with phones earned a reputation for being nearly indestructible. The brand pioneered mobile technology features like T9 predictive text and early mobile multimedia.

  • Why did Nokia fall behind in smartphones?

    Reviewers note that Nokia failed to adapt to the smartphone era by clinging too long to the outdated Symbian operating system. When Nokia pivoted to Windows Phone, the hardware was attractive but lacked essential apps and ecosystem support.

  • Who should buy a Nokia phone today?

    Nokia is best for people seeking a simple backup phone for occasional use, digital detox weekends, or those chasing nostalgia for the pre-smartphone era. Modern Nokia phones are feature phones or low-end devices, not primary smartphones.

  • Is a Nokia phone right for me if I need a primary smartphone?

    No. Reviewers say Nokia phones are not suitable for anyone who needs a primary smartphone with a modern app ecosystem, competitive performance, or cutting-edge features. Modern revivals cannot compete with contemporary smartphones.

  • What do reviewers say about Nokia's battery life?

    Reviewers highlight long battery life as a standout Nokia strength, with feature phones providing days or even a week of standby. This is one of the traits AI ranks highly for Nokia phones.
